The Penicillin cocktail was a fusion of Japanese whiskey, scotch, honey, ginger, and lemon. The balance of flavors was impeccable, with the smoky notes of the whiskey harmonizing beautifully with the citrusy zing of lemon and ginger, and the soothing sweetness of honey. It was a true palate pleaser. The Cucumber Sake Martini mixed sake, vodka, and cucumber water in a refreshing and inventive way. The cucumber water lent a crisp, cooling quality to the drink, while the sake added a slight sweetness, and the vodka provided a subtle kick. It was a perfect accompaniment to the sushi dishes, cleansing the palate between bites.

Dining at Zama sushi in Philadelphia was an experience to remember. Nestled amongst the city's culinary gems, Zama has rightfully earned its place in our top 10 favorite sushi spots. The ambiance of the restaurant sets the tone for an intimate and upscale dining affair. Starting with drinks, the cucumber saketini was refreshingly crisp, offering a perfect balance of sweet and tart, while the penicillin with Japanese whiskey showcased a harmonious blend of smokiness and tang. Moving on to the food, the pork dumplings were succulent, with a savory filling that tantalized the taste buds. The edamame, though simple, was seasoned perfectly, setting the stage for what was to come. The rock shrimp tempura was a delightful surprise, crispy on the outside yet tender inside. The sushi rolls were the real showstopper. The tuna avocado roll and sesame salmon roll were fresh and packed with flavor. The Philly style roll was a unique take, merging the iconic cheesesteak flavors with traditional sushi - an adventurous and tasty blend. Lastly, the rainbow black belt roll was a beautiful medley of fish on top of a sumptuous roll, a feast for both the eyes and palate. Every bite at Zama was a journey of flavors, solidifying its reputation as a must-visit in Philadelphia.
